Just to be clear, the turn indicator in the dash is lite with the headlights are turned on, but if you turn the right side turn signals on it blinks? Is that reading it correctly.
If so it would appear that you have a ground problem on the right side front turn/park light. Either ground wire, socket, or bulb. Are you sure the right front turn light is working and is as bright as the left side?

As the guys mentioned above, the glowing turn signal lamp usually means a burned-out bulb or a bad connection somewhere. Also, keep in mind that the front side marker lights are supposed to blink with the turn signals.

yep, the front bulb has lost it's ground and the parking light circuit is finding it's ground through the turn signal filament all the way back to the indicator bulb in the dash.

Originally posted by gofast250: But how does one lose a ground ,comes lose or ?.
the "vampire teeth" in the side of the socket need to touch the metal base of the bulb. that's one place the screw that grounds the wire's eyelet to the frame, that's another place. a problem with the wiring, (unlikely) but that's about the last place.
quote
Originally posted by gofast250: Also should the rear red side light blink with the signal as well
no

All the front lights ground under a screw on the inside fender right by the headlight buckets. Just look down between the light and the inner finder you should see it.... There is one on both sides.
